scrapyをubuntuにインストールする方法です。
0 1 2 3 4 5 6 |
//ubuntu sudo python3.11 -m pip install pip install scrapy //basic $ pip install scrapy |
インストール後、Scrapyの startprojectoを実行したところ以下のエラーが出ました。
0 1 2 |
AttributeError: module 'lib' has no attribute 'X509_V_FLAG_NOTIFY_POLICY'. Did you mean: 'X509_V_FLAG_EXPLICIT_POLICY'? |
python 3.11 の環境で「pyOpenSSL」のバージョンに問題がありました。
0 1 2 3 |
$ sudo python3.11 -m pip install pyOpenSSL==24.0.0 Collecting pyOpenSSL==24.0.0 |
この後に $ scrapy startproject [AppName] を実行したら成功しました。